Thorizon is a deep-tech startup based in Amsterdam and Lyon that specializes in the development of thorium molten salt reactor technology aimed at sustainable energy production. Originating as a spin-off from the Dutch Nuclear Research Institute, the company seeks to create small modular nuclear reactors that complement renewable sources such as wind and solar. Thorizon is focused on rapidly developing a reactor that is both safe and capable of utilizing long-lived nuclear waste as fuel, thereby contributing to circular energy solutions. The company is currently enhancing its financial position to construct a non-nuclear molten salt demonstrator and finalize the design for its first reactor, Thorizon One, slated for completion by 2030. Collaborating with industry leaders like Orano, Tractebel, and EDF, Thorizon is recognized as a key player in advanced nuclear projects, being a laureate in the France 2030 program.

EST-Floattech BV, founded in 2009 and based in Medemblik, the Netherlands, specializes in the development and manufacture of energy storage systems utilizing lithium polymer batteries for maritime and land-based applications. The company focuses on creating intelligent energy solutions that promote cleaner, safer, and more reliable energy sources. Its product portfolio encompasses a wide range of maritime projects, including superyachts, ferries, inland shipping, and defense applications. By providing robust energy storage systems, EST-Floattech aims to help marine industries lower harmful emissions, such as nitrogen oxides and carbon dioxide, while also minimizing engine noise and unpleasant odors, thereby contributing to a healthier environment.
E-magy is an advanced materials company that specializes in supplying nano-porous silicon for high-energy lithium-ion batteries. Located near Amsterdam, the Netherlands, E-magy employs a unique silicon crystallization process that enhances energy density by 40%, making its materials suitable for use in electric vehicle batteries. The company’s innovative silicon is compatible with existing production lines in Gigafactories, allowing for scalable manufacturing. E-magy aims to support automotive and battery manufacturers in achieving superior battery performance, enabling long-range and fast-charging capabilities at competitive costs. With a team of experts boasting over 20 years of experience in silicon crystallization, E-magy is committed to advancing clean, electrically-powered mobility for all.

MX3D specializes in large-scale robotic 3D printing technology, focusing on metal fabrication through wire arc additive manufacturing (WAAM). The company is recognized as an industry leader and provides a comprehensive turnkey solution that integrates sensors, software, robots, and welding equipment. Their proprietary software, MetalXL, supports the entire printing process, offering features like computer-aided manufacturing (CAM), feasibility checks, tool path planning, active monitoring, and data logging, all tailored for WAAM applications. Additionally, MX3D offers in-house part production for clients who are evaluating the purchase of their machines, catering to various industries and enabling faster, more cost-effective 3D metal printing solutions.

S4 Energy is a Netherlands-based company that specializes in developing and delivering customized energy storage solutions aimed at stabilizing the supply and demand of renewable energy. Founded in 2010 and headquartered in Rotterdam, S4 Energy collaborates with grid operators, energy consumers, and renewable energy sources. The company offers a range of services, including frequency containment reserve services for the Dutch grid operator TenneT TSO, and it manufactures KINEXT units in Almelo. S4 Energy provides comprehensive solutions encompassing design, construction, and maintenance, along with software that analyzes energy flows for optimized management. Its hardware offerings include various storage technologies such as kinetic storage (flywheels), chemical storage (batteries), electrolytic storage (capacitors), and power conversion systems. By integrating innovative technologies with economic insights, S4 Energy focuses on delivering reliable and cost-effective energy solutions for energy generation, transport, distribution, industrial consumers, and public infrastructure.

Asperitas is a clean-tech company dedicated to transforming the datacentre industry through its innovative Immersed Computing technology. Established in 2014, Asperitas focuses on developing a comprehensive immersion cooling system that enhances the performance and reliability of data centers while promoting sustainability. By integrating power and network components with advanced liquid immersion cooling technologies, the company provides an effective solution that minimizes energy consumption and reduces emissions. This design approach not only prevents heat shutdowns but also ensures that the technology can be utilized in a wide range of applications, making it a versatile choice for modern data center operations.

Mud Jeans is a manufacturer of denim-based clothing that focuses on sustainable fashion. The company offers a range of products, including jeans, shirts, bags, shorts, and jackets, crafted from natural materials and organic or recycled cotton. Mud Jeans operates an online marketplace where customers can purchase their apparel. A unique aspect of their business model is the option for customers to lease jeans, allowing them to return the items later in exchange for a new pair. This circular design approach promotes sustainability and encourages responsible consumption in the fashion industry.

CoVadem specializes in depth measurement and forecasting technology for inland shipping. The company develops a platform that collects and analyzes data from various ships, transforming isolated information into valuable insights about water depth on shipping lanes. By applying collaborative big data principles, CoVadem offers predictive analytics that help ship owners and operators understand river behavior and optimize their operational performance. This innovative approach provides the inland waterways transport industry with essential information services, ultimately enhancing vessel development and improving transportation efficiency.
